Install NVIDIA Driver on Fedora 12 Beta (64bit)

Enable the rpm-fusion repositories.

Download packages from http://koji.fedoraproject.org/koji/taskinfo?taskID=1763452:
xorg-x11-drv-nvidia-190.42-1.fc12.x86_64.rpm
xorg-x11-drv-nvidia-libs-190.42-1.fc12.x86_64.rpm

Install it:

$sudo yum install livna-config-display system-config-display

Download http://leigh123linux.fedorapeople.org/pub/srpm/nvidia-kmod-190.42-3.fc12.src.rpm and install it,
then change your directory to /root/rpmbuild/SPECS

Build the rpm packages:

# rpmbuild bb target=x86_64 nvidia-kmod.SPEC 

then you should get the four files in your rpmbuild folder /root/rpmbuild/RPMS/x86_64/:

#ls 
akmod-nvidia-190.42-3.fc12.x86_64.rpm
kmod-nvidia-190.42-3.fc12.x86_64.rpm
kmod-nvidia-2.6.31.1-56.fc12.x86_64-190.42-3.fc12.x86_64.rpm
nvidia-kmod-debuginfo-190.42-3.fc12.x86_64.rpm

move xorg nvidia files to the x86_64 folder: xorg-x11-drv-nvidia-*-190.42-1.fc12.x86_64.rpm, then install them, six files, together.

# rpm -ivh *.rpm

There must be a final step to finish your driver installation:
edit your /etc/modprobe.d/blacklist.conf to add the line:

blacklist nouveau

and edit your starting manager /etc/grub.conf to add the parameter to the end of kernel line:

nouveau.modeset=0

Then you can see your Linux Display as you do before.
